Course structure

• Introduction to Mobility and Aging
• Physiology of Aging
• Mobility Assessment Tools
• Assistive Devices and Technologies
• Exercise and Mobility
• Falls Prevention
• Environmental Modifications
• Community Resources for Aging Population
• Ethical Considerations in Mobility and Aging
• Case Studies and Practical Applications

Career path

Career Roles Key Responsibilities
Mobility Specialist Assess and improve mobility for aging individuals
Aging in Place Consultant Provide recommendations for aging individuals to stay in their homes
Senior Fitness Trainer Design exercise programs for older adults to improve strength and flexibility
Geriatric Care Manager Coordinate care services for elderly clients
